Techniques for signoff?Who makes decisions?Process drivenUser focusedDealing with feedbackThe homepage battle
Who makes decisions?Avoid a committeeAvoid on the fly compromiseBut do collaborateUse stakeholder interviewsReporting backThe need for authority
Process drivenExplain the process upfrontRequirement gatheringLOTS of input during processShow, don’t sayPresent backed with evidence
e.g. the design process
User focusedAvoid personal opinionWhat would users think?Use personasDesign testing
Dealing with feedbackProblems not solutionsAlways ask whyIndividual feedbackAlways include user feedbackReport back
The homepage battleThe changing roleAvoid rushing inCommunicate simplicity
and slippagescope creep
Your techniques?Have a project structureSet expectationsDefine participants roleInternal charging
Project structureStatement of workMilestones (you and client)Client signoff
Set expectationsHow the process worksWhat they will see whenHow decisions are made
Their roleWhat you expect from themFocus on objectivesFocus on usersProvide contentIdentify problems not solutions
Internal chargingPrevents scope creepIncreases perceived valueBeyond your control?Track effortEquate effort to costReport to management
problem peoplepolitics
How do you cope?Accept itKeep talkingAvoid confrontationEmpathise
Accept itPolitics exists everywhereYou cannot ‘rise above it’You cannot control othersBe patientFind supporters(internal and external)
Keep talkingAvoid departmental dividesUse stakeholder meetingsde-brief from projectsEstablish regular meetings
Avoid confrontationNever say noExplain consequencesPraise positive commentsDon’t become defensiveAllow others to defend you
EmpathiseKnow peoples painIdentify key influencersShow not tell
